About BodyIQ

BodyIQ is a mobile app designed for iPhone and iPad that analyzes users' physiques by estimating body fat percentage and scoring major muscle groups through a single photo. Utilizing artificial intelligence and computer vision, BodyIQ provides a comprehensive overview of a user's body composition, including personalized feedback and a 12-week transformation blueprint tailored to individual fitness goals. Users can track their progress over time with weekly scans, gamification features, and daily streaks to maintain motivation.

An early, revenue-stage AI body-fat analysis app bringing in $397 over the last 30 days with $314 in MRR and an unusually high 98% margin.

BodyIQ is a compact, revenue-generating mobile app (founded 2025-11-01) focused on AI-driven body-fat analysis. The product shows early commercial traction: recurring revenue of $314, total of $397 in the last 30 days, and positive momentum with +7% month-over-month growth. The reported 98% margin suggests a very low-cost digital delivery model or accounting that heavily favors profitability at this scale.

Key operational signal: the company is listed for sale, which can mean the founders are pursuing an exit or want to transfer ownership at this early stage. For a buyer or investor, the combination of small but recurring revenue, steady short-term growth, and a high margin frames this as a low-complexity asset that needs scale — user acquisition, product validation at larger volumes, and regulatory/market positioning in health-adjacent software will determine whether it grows or remains a niche earnout.

Strengths

Has paying customers and recurring revenue ($314), not just downloads or prototypes
Positive short-term growth at +7% shows momentum
Very high reported profitability (98%) points to a low-cost, digital-native model
Narrow, defensible niche — AI body-fat analysis — that can be vertically marketed

What to watch

Absolute revenue is small ($397), so scale is required to make this a meaningful business
Being listed for sale is a mixed signal — could be an intentional exit or a need to transfer because growth isn’t accelerating
Product is in a health-related area; buyer/investor should verify compliance, data-privacy posture, and clinical claims independently
Customer acquisition and retention economics will determine viability once growth stalls or marketing spend rises
